HOME
CallUpContact - The Next Best Online Phonebook & Directory
Help customers find you  


Nelson Alarm

2602 E 55th St, Indianapolis
46220
  IN
Indiana
United States

Tel: +1 317-255-2125

Directions to Nelson Alarm

Accuracy Vote:
GoodBad
00

Map lookup:



© copyright Callupcontact 2025
All Rights Reserved